Transaction 1f31bb2ce78daeba9d2f88201446586806fdafddabd854148392d5821d6ac155
1 Input
1 Output
-
1f31bb2ce78daeba9d2f88201446586806fdafddabd854148392d5821d6ac155:0
- value
- 703631
- script pubkey
- OP_0 OP_PUSHBYTES_20 c23a8e33c8acac468985d06e01725e55c12553bb
- address
- bc1qcgaguv7g4jkydzv96phqzuj72hqj25amn37vwy